Video: Ryan Newman Suffers Cut Tire, Smacks Wall to End Stage 3 of Coca-Cola 600

Horrible luck for Ryan Newman, who was running in 12th-position near the end of Stage 3 in Sunday’s NASCAR Cup Series Coca-Cola 600. As Newman was working on passing Joey Logano for 11th, a tire let go on the No. 6 Roush Fenway Racing Ford, which sent Newman hard into the wall.

Newman will enter the final stage of the race three laps down in 29th.

The 43-year old had a solid three-race stretch between Talladega and Darlington, as he had an average finish of 13th during that span. However, he has failed to finish inside the top-20 in every race since. That streak will continue in the Coca-Cola 600.
